Understanding Shingle Roof Replacement Costs in Escondido

The cost of replacing a shingle roof in Escondido can vary widely depending on several factors. According to recent data, the average roof replacement price in California is around $19,229. However, this figure can fluctuate based on your specific circumstances. Let’s break down the key elements that influence the cost:

1. Roof Size and Complexity

The size of your roof is one of the most significant factors in determining the cost of replacement. In Escondido, the average home size is approximately 1,650 square feet. However, it’s important to note that roof size is typically measured in “squares,” with one square equaling 100 square feet. The complexity of your roof, including its pitch, number of valleys, and overall design, can also impact the cost.

2. Shingle Material and Quality

The type and quality of shingles you choose will significantly affect the overall cost. Options range from basic three-tab asphalt shingles to more premium architectural or designer shingles. While higher-quality materials may come with a higher upfront cost, they often offer better durability and longevity, potentially saving you money in the long run.

3. Removal of Existing Roof

If your current roof needs to be removed before the new one can be installed, this will add to the overall cost. The expense of tear-off and disposal can vary based on the number of layers that need to be removed and local disposal fees.

4. Additional Components

A complete roof replacement often involves more than just shingles. You may need to replace underlayment, flashing, vents, and other components. These additional materials and labor will contribute to the total cost.

5. Labor Costs

Labor costs can vary among shingle roof replacement contractors in Escondido. Factors such as the contractor’s experience, reputation, and workload can influence their pricing. It’s essential to get quotes from multiple reputable contractors to ensure you’re getting a fair price for quality work.

6. Permits and Inspections

Don’t forget to factor in the cost of necessary permits and inspections required by the City of Escondido. These fees can add to your overall project cost but are crucial for ensuring your roof replacement meets local building codes and standards.

 

Average Cost Ranges for Shingle Roof Replacement in Escondido

Based on data from various sources, including local roofing contractors and cost estimation services, here are some approximate price ranges for shingle roof replacement in Escondido:

  • Basic Asphalt Shingles: $3.50 – $5.50 per square foot
  • Architectural Shingles: $4.50 – $7.00 per square foot
  • Premium Designer Shingles: $6.00 – $10.00 per square foot

For a typical 1,650 square foot home in Escondido, this could translate to a total cost range of:

  • Basic Asphalt Shingles: $5,775 – $9,075
  • Architectural Shingles: $7,425 – $11,550
  • Premium Designer Shingles: $9,900 – $16,500

Remember, these are rough estimates, and your actual costs may vary based on the specific factors of your project. It’s always best to get detailed quotes from reputable shingle roof replacement companies in Escondido for the most accurate pricing.

Financing Options for Roof Replacement in Escondido

Given the significant investment required for a roof replacement, many homeowners in Escondido seek financing options to manage the cost. Here are several financing alternatives to consider:

1. Home Equity Loans or Lines of Credit

If you have built up equity in your home, you may be able to leverage it through a home equity loan or line of credit. These options often come with lower interest rates compared to other financing methods, as they are secured by your property.

2. FHA Title I Home and Property Improvement Loans

The Federal Housing Administration (FHA) offers Title I loans specifically for home improvements, including roof replacements. These loans are available for homeowners with limited equity and can be a good option for those who don’t qualify for home equity financing.

3. Personal Loans

Unsecured personal loans from banks, credit unions, or online lenders can be another option for financing your roof replacement. While interest rates may be higher than secured loans, the application process is often quicker, and you don’t need to put up your home as collateral.

4. Credit Cards

For smaller roof repair or partial replacement projects, using a credit card might be an option. Some homeowners opt for credit cards with introductory 0% APR offers, which can provide interest-free financing if paid off within the promotional period. However, be cautious with this approach, as credit card interest rates can be very high if the balance isn’t paid off quickly.

5. Contractor Financing

Many shingle roof replacement contractors in Escondido offer their own financing options or partner with lenders to provide financing solutions. These can range from short-term payment plans to longer-term loans. Be sure to compare these offers with other financing options to ensure you’re getting the best deal.

6. Government Assistance Programs

Depending on your circumstances, you may qualify for government assistance programs for home repairs and improvements. For example, the Single Family Housing Repair Loans & Grants program offered by the U.S. Department of Agriculture provides loans and grants to very-low-income homeowners to repair, improve, or modernize their homes, including roof replacements.

Choosing the Right Shingle Roof Replacement Contractors in Escondido for Your Roof Replacement

While cost is a significant factor in your roof replacement project, it’s equally important to choose a reputable and skilled contractor. Here are some tips for selecting the right shingle roof replacement contractor in Escondido:

  • Check for Proper Licensing and Insurance: Ensure the contractor is licensed to work in Escondido and carries adequate insurance coverage.
  • Read Reviews and Ask for References: Look for customer reviews online and ask the contractor for references from recent local projects.
  • Get Multiple Quotes: Obtain detailed quotes from at least three different shingle roof replacement companies in Escondido to compare pricing and services offered.
  • Ask About Warranties: Inquire about both manufacturer warranties on materials and workmanship warranties offered by the contractor.
  • Verify Experience: Choose a contractor with significant experience in shingle roof replacements, particularly in the Escondido area.
  • Communication and Professionalism: Pay attention to how the contractor communicates with you and their level of professionalism throughout the quoting process.
